Paperbabe Stamps - New Release - Peony Stamp Set

Hiya I have some Brilliant News.... Paperbabe Stamps has re-released the Peony Stamp Set but this time in Clear Polymer and Bigger!!! and we all know that Bigger is Better!!!

Today I am sharing with you my project using the new set which includes a large peony, a bud and 2 leaves, all separate so you can add and layer up as you like.


First I stamped the Peony and the leaves onto the front of a 6x6 cardblank which I coloured using pencils. I then stamped the peony 3 more times onto scrap card and coloured them using pencils, I then fussy cut out the layers of the peony and decoupaged them up using foam pads to add dimension. I stamped the 'You Are Beautiful' You Quote stamp into the top corner of the card using archival ink. To finish I inked the card edges using 'Fired Brick' Distress Ink.

This is a quick little make but was a lot of fun to create and would be easy enough to create many times for batch cardmaking or could also be altered to use as invitations etc
